Before we jump into specific recommendations, let’s talk about what makes a sim racing wheel tick. The most important feature is force feedback. This is what simulates the feeling of the car reacting to the road, the tires losing grip, and the forces you’d experience in a real race car. A good force feedback system will transmit detailed information, allowing you to feel subtle changes in the track surface and the car’s behavior.

Think of it like this: imagine driving a real car and feeling the bumps in the road through the steering wheel. Force feedback tries to replicate that feeling in your sim racing setup. The stronger and more nuanced the force feedback, the more immersive and realistic the experience.

Beyond force feedback, consider the wheel’s build quality. Is it made of durable materials? Will it withstand the rigors of intense racing sessions? Look for wheels with sturdy construction, especially in the wheel rim and the pedal assembly. You’ll also want to consider the number of buttons and paddles on the wheel. These allow you to adjust settings on the fly, like brake bias, traction control, and fuel mix, without having to fumble with your keyboard or mouse.

Types of Sim Racing Wheels: From Entry-Level to Professional

Sim racing wheels generally fall into a few different categories:

  • Entry-Level Wheels: These are typically the most affordable options, often using a simpler force feedback system. They’re a great starting point for beginners who want to get a taste of sim racing without breaking the bank. While they might not offer the same level of realism as higher-end wheels, they still provide a significant improvement over using a gamepad. In 2025, we anticipate entry-level wheels will see improvements in force feedback fidelity and build quality, perhaps incorporating newer technologies trickling down from the more expensive models.
  • Mid-Range Wheels: This category offers a sweet spot between price and performance. These wheels generally feature stronger and more detailed force feedback systems, as well as better build quality and more customization options. They’re a great choice for sim racers who are serious about the hobby and want a more immersive experience. In 2025, we expect to see even more refined force feedback in this segment, potentially incorporating haptic feedback or other advanced technologies to further enhance realism.
  • High-End/Direct Drive Wheels: These are the pinnacle of sim racing wheels. Direct drive wheels connect the wheel rim directly to the motor, eliminating the belts or gears used in other types of wheels. This results in incredibly strong and precise force feedback, providing the most realistic and immersive experience possible. These wheels are typically the most expensive option, but they offer unparalleled performance.   • Pedals: The Unsung Heroes of Sim Racing

    While the wheel gets most of the attention, the pedals are just as important for a realistic sim racing experience. They allow you to control the throttle, brakes, and clutch (if you’re using a manual gearbox). Just like wheels, pedals come in different levels of quality.

  • Entry-Level Pedals: These often come bundled with entry-level wheels and are typically made of plastic. They might not offer the most precise control, but they’re a good starting point.
  • Mid-Range Pedals: These pedals are usually made of metal and offer a more realistic feel. They often feature load cell brakes, which measure the force you apply to the pedal rather than the distance it travels. This allows for more consistent and precise braking.
  • High-End Pedals: These are the most advanced pedals available, offering the ultimate in realism and adjustability. They often feature high-quality materials, load cell brakes, and a variety of adjustments to fine-tune the feel of the pedals.

    Thinking Ahead: Ecosystem and Compatibility

    Before you make a purchase, consider the sim racing ecosystem you want to be a part of. Some manufacturers offer a range of products, including wheels, pedals, shifters, and handbrakes, that are designed to work together seamlessly. This can make it easier to upgrade your setup over time.

    Also, make sure the wheel you choose is compatible with the games you want to play. Most sim racing wheels are compatible with popular titles like Assetto Corsa, iRacing, and rFactor 2, but it’s always best to double-check before you buy.     Wheels: The Feel of the Road

    Let’s start with the most crucial piece of the puzzle: the steering wheel. This is your direct connection to the virtual asphalt, the instrument through which you’ll feel every bump, every camber change, every tire slip. It’s more than just a controller; it’s an extension of your racing instincts.

    In 2025, the sim racing wheel market is bursting with options, from entry-level marvels to high-end professional-grade equipment. For newcomers, a good starting point is a force feedback wheel. Force feedback is the magic that makes sim racing feel so immersive. It simulates the forces you’d experience in a real car, from the resistance of the tires to the jolts of impacts. Imagine feeling the subtle vibrations as you approach the limit of grip, or the powerful kickback as you power out of a corner. That’s force feedback in action!

    Entry-level wheels often use a gear-driven or belt-driven system for force feedback. Gear-driven wheels are generally more affordable but can be a bit noisy and less smooth. Belt-driven wheels offer a smoother and more refined experience, with greater fidelity in the force feedback. As you progress and your budget allows, you might consider direct drive wheels. These are the pinnacle of sim racing wheel technology, connecting the wheel directly to a powerful motor. Direct drive wheels provide the most realistic and detailed force feedback, allowing you to feel every nuance of the virtual road.

    Beyond the force feedback system, consider the wheel’s size, shape, and materials. Do you prefer a smaller, more nimble wheel for open-wheel racing, or a larger, more substantial wheel for GT cars? Do you like the feel of leather, Alcantara, or a more minimalist design? These are all personal preferences that will influence your choice. Many wheels also offer customizable buttons, paddles, and displays, allowing you to tailor the controls to your specific needs.

    Pedals: The Dance of Acceleration and Braking

    Next up are the pedals. While often overlooked, the pedals are just as important as the wheel in controlling your car. They’re your connection to the engine’s power and the car’s braking system, allowing you to fine-tune your inputs and maximize your performance.

    Just like wheels, pedals come in a variety of styles and price points. Entry-level pedal sets often feature a simple plastic construction, while higher-end sets use metal components for increased durability and realism. The key to a good set of pedals is adjustability. You should be able to adjust the pedal’s position, angle, and resistance to suit your driving style.

    Consider the type of pedal technology. Some pedals use potentiometers to measure your input, while others use load cells. Load cell pedals measure the force you apply to the pedal, rather than the distance it travels. This provides a more realistic and consistent braking feel, as it more accurately simulates the forces you’d experience in a real car. Load cell pedals are generally more expensive but are a worthwhile investment for serious sim racers.

    Shifters: Gear Up for Immersion

    For those who crave the full manual experience, a shifter is a must-have. Shifters allow you to manually change gears, adding another layer of realism and control to your sim racing experience.

    Shifters come in two main types: H-pattern and sequential. H-pattern shifters mimic the traditional gearboxes found in many road cars, requiring you to move the gear lever through a specific pattern to change gears. Sequential shifters, on the other hand, allow you to shift gears up and down with a simple push or pull of the lever. Sequential shifters are often preferred for racing cars with sequential gearboxes, such as those found in many modern race cars.

    Rigs: Your Virtual Cockpit

    Now, let’s talk about rigs. A sim racing rig is essentially the framework that holds your wheel, pedals, and shifter. It’s your virtual cockpit, the place where you’ll spend countless hours honing your skills and battling for virtual victories.

    Rigs range from simple wheel stands to full-blown racing cockpits. Wheel stands are a good option for beginners, as they’re compact and affordable. However, they can be less stable than dedicated rigs. As you progress, you might consider investing in a more robust rig that can accommodate a wider range of hardware and provide a more immersive experience.

    Full-blown racing cockpits offer the ultimate in adjustability and immersion. They often feature adjustable seats, pedal positions, and wheel mounts, allowing you to create the perfect driving position. Some high-end rigs even incorporate motion platforms, which simulate the movement of the car, further enhancing the realism.
